
Veps Takes a Deep Dive into Emotion with New Single ‘Break & Entry’

The ever-evolving soundscape of indie music thrives on the pulse of innovation and emotional depth. Norway’s own Veps have embodied this spirit in their latest single, ‘Break & Entry’, extracted from their keenly awaited album ‘Dedicated To’. It’s more than a song; it’s a journey through the chambers of introspection and vulnerability, all set to the tune of a piano-driven ballad that embraces the softer edges of the human experience.
- Producer Marcus Forsgren and mixer Matias Tellez, known for polishing the sounds of indie icons like Girl In Red, have lent their magic to ‘Break & Entry’.
- The song explores the hollowness that resonates after pouring heart and soul into a relationship, only to be met with silence.
- Veps, harnessing the wisdom accrued from teenage years to their current 20-something reality, have traced an impressive arc since their initial burst into the music scene with their debut EP ‘Open The Door’.
From captivating the stages at The Great Escape to their explosive presence at Norway’s Øyafestival, Veps have not only matured but have also reshaped their sound to express the complexity of human feelings and the bittersweet tang of unrequited efforts in relationships.
